| Don’t let your website sleep |
You have spent a fortune and empanelled a professional designer to set up a website? You went an extra mile and listed your business on various business directories that are relevant to your business like BigOtrade? You had set up an opt-in form, started to build your client list and you even plan to send them a newsletter. But there is a small problem; you don’t see much business coming your way in spite of taking all the trouble. The traffic to your site is laughable. Why?
It’s content.
On the internet, content is like oxygen. If the surfers don’t get enough of it, they would die. People come online for information. They seek answers to their queries and they want them yesterday. The solution your product or service provides is a kind of information that they certainly want to know about -- BigOtrade would be a great start. But then, just throwing a well-designed website on their face isn’t going to cut the ice.
You got to have a constant influx of well-developed, well-written and unique, engaging content -- the kind of stuff that would be hard to find elsewhere on the web and the web surfers would be glad to pay money for (surprise! We still give it away for free on our site)
A website with boring, superfluous, grandiloquent and jargon filled content is a total put off. Look, you might be selling the world’s greatest software and you understand it well. It doesn’t mean that you write exactly what you know because chances are that your customer won’t understand any of it. Guess what? He doesn’t even care. He can even settle for the world’s second best, third best or perhaps even let go of his idea to buy it entirely. Who loses? Do pray that none of your competitors would get to sell their software to him just because their website had information about their product in a story like form that even a 5 year old kid could understand. They made the sale, you may cry now.
Not only must your website have relevant content written in a friendly way, as if there is a real person talking to your potential client in a language your client understands and explains every teeny-weeny bit of detail that might confound the client. Not only that, the website should also contain a lot of information relevant to the kind of customer found on your website, which invariably depends on what you sell. For instance, if you checked out www.bigotrade.com, you might understand right away that more often than not, it is small business entrepreneurs who are found looking for information on this site. So, it is apt that we have a lot of information regarding setting up, running, operating, maintaining and marketing businesses. It would have content related to online marketing, e-commerce and the like.
A website with a few pages like “about us”, ‘Contact us” and “Products” is boring. These websites are dead. They are like dead meat dried for the vultures to eat and even the vultures might opt for meat that is much fresher and juicier.
